Fort Ross

★★★★☆ (153)

A beach entry can make this site tricky if the surge is coming in from the wrong direction. Once in the water there are a couple of options. To the NW you can find a series of pinnacles and the remains of an old wreck (nothing to penetrate). To the south, you will find a series of rock walls.

Many pinnacles are covered with metridium anemones. Lots of fish life, including lingcod, cabezon, and rockfish. Also bountiful nudibranchs of all the colors of the rainbow.
